
body{
background:  url(images/bg.gif);
background-repeat:repeat-x;
background-position:bottom;
background-attachment:fixed;
background-color:#eeeeee;
}

.white{
font-family:Arial, Helvetica, sans-serif;
color:#FFFFFF;
font-size:12px;
line-height:17px;
}
.leipis{
font-family:verdana,Georgia, serif;
color:#000000;
font-size:11px;
}
.otsikko{

font-family:Arial, Helvetica, sans-serif;
color:#939293;
font-size:12px;
font-weight:bold;
}
.taulukko{
background:  url(images/aluevalikko_bg.gif);
##border: 1px solid #CCCCCC;
}

a{
font-family:Arial, Helvetica, sans-serif;
color:#0068ae;
font-size:11px;
line-height:17px;
text-decoration: none;
}

a.tc{
background:  url(images/t_c_bg.gif);
width:170px;
height:17px;
font-family:Arial, Helvetica, sans-serif;
color:#FFFFFF;
font-size:11px;
line-height:22px;
text-decoration: none;
}
a.tb{
background:  url(images/tcb_bg.gif);
width:170px;
height:17px;
font-family:Arial, Helvetica, sans-serif;
color:#FFFFFF;
font-size:11px;
line-height:22px;
text-decoration: none;
}
a.oasis{
background:  url(images/oasis_bg.gif);
width:45px;
height:16px;
font-family:Arial, Helvetica, sans-serif;
color:#FFFFFF;
font-size:11px;
line-height:20px;
text-decoration: none;
}
a.oasis:hover{
background:  url(images/oasis_bg.gif);
width:45px;
height:16px;
font-family:Arial, Helvetica, sans-serif;
color:#FFFFFF;
font-size:11px;
line-height:20px;
text-decoration: none;
}

.aluevalikko{
font-family:Arial, Helvetica, sans-serif;
color:#8e8c87;
font-size:11px;
line-height:22px;
text-transform: uppercase;
text-decoration: none;
}
.aluevalikko_active{
font-family:Arial, Helvetica, sans-serif;
color:#FFFFFF;
font-size:11px;
line-height:22px;
text-transform: uppercase;
text-decoration: none;
}
a.aluevalikko_active:hover{
font-family:Arial, Helvetica, sans-serif;
color:#FFFFFF;
font-size:11px;
line-height:22px;
text-transform: uppercase;
text-decoration: none;
}
a.aluevalikko:hover{
font-family:Arial, Helvetica, sans-serif;
color:#FFFFFF;
font-size:11px;
line-height:22px;
text-transform: uppercase;
text-decoration: none;
}

a:hover{
font-family:Arial, Helvetica, sans-serif;
color:9f773b;
font-size:11px;
line-height:17px;
text-decoration: none;
}
.nuoli{
font-family:Arial, Helvetica, sans-serif;
color:9f773b;
font-size:16px;
font-weight: bold;
}

#meri{
background:  url(images/meri.jpg);
background-repeat:no-repeat;
background-position:bottom right;
}
#luonto{
background:  url(images/luonto.jpg);
background-repeat:no-repeat;
background-position:bottom right;
}
#yleista{
background:  url(images/yleista.jpg);
background-repeat:no-repeat;
background-position:bottom left;
}
#palvelut{
background:  url(images/palvelut.jpg);
	background-repeat:no-repeat;
background-position:bottom left;

}

#asunnot{
background:  url(images/asunnot.jpg);
	background-repeat:no-repeat;
background-position:bottom left;

}

#kartta{
background:  url(images/kartta.jpg);
	background-repeat:no-repeat;
background-position:bottom left;

}